Typical Lifespan of Water Heaters

The typical lifespan of a water heater varies based on its type and maintenance. Traditional tank water heaters usually last between 10 to 15 years, while tankless models can extend that lifespan to around 20 years. Factors such as water quality, sediment buildup, and frequency of use play significant roles in determining how long a unit will function effectively. Homeowners should regularly check for signs of deterioration as they approach this age range.

When to Replace vs. Repair

Determining whether to replace or repair a water heater hinges on various factors, including the age of the unit and the extent of the damage. A typical water heater has a lifespan of about 10 to 15 years. If your unit is nearing the end of this range and requires frequent repairs, replacement may be the most cost-effective option. Moreover, safety concerns, such as leaks or rust, can signal that a full replacement is necessary.

FAQS

What is the average cost to replace a water heater in California?

The average cost to replace a water heater in California typically ranges from $1,000 to $3,000, depending on factors such as the type and size of the unit, installation complexities, and the contractor’s fees.

Are there additional costs associated with replacing a water heater?

Yes, additional costs may include permits, disposal fees for the old unit, and potential upgrades to plumbing or electrical systems to accommodate the new water heater.

How can I find a reputable contractor for water heater replacement?

To find a reputable contractor, check online reviews, ask for recommendations from friends or family, and verify the contractor’s experience, licenses, and insurance coverage.

What types of water heaters are available in California?

California residents can choose from various types of water heaters, including tankless, traditional tank-style, solar, and heat pump water heaters, each offering different benefits and costs.
